The Left Towing Hook Rear Bracket is a critical structural component designed for vehicles equipped with or intended for a towing system. Engineered to provide a secure and robust mounting point on the left rear side of the vehicle’s chassis or frame, this bracket serves as the foundational link between your vehicle and the towing hook or tow ball assembly. Its primary function is to safely distribute the substantial forces encountered during towing, recovery, or winching operations, thereby protecting the vehicle’s unibody or frame from stress and potential damage.

Constructed from high-grade, laser-cut steel or reinforced alloy, this bracket undergoes rigorous fabrication processes, including precision welding and anti-corrosion treatments such as powder coating or galvanization. This ensures exceptional durability and long-term resistance to rust, even under harsh environmental conditions. Vehicle-specific design is paramount; each bracket is meticulously engineered to match the exact bolt patterns, contours, and clearances of the designated make and model. This guarantees a perfect fit without interference with existing components like the bumper, exhaust, or underbody panels.

Installation of this essential towing component requires careful attention. It is strongly recommended to follow the manufacturer’s provided instructions or seek professional assistance to ensure all mounting points are secured to the vehicle’s primary structural members using the correct hardware torque specifications. A properly installed left towing hook rear bracket is indispensable for safe towing practices, providing the driver with confidence that their trailer, caravan, or other loads are connected to a solid and reliable anchor point. Always verify that the bracket’s load rating complies with your vehicle’s maximum towing capacity and the intended application.
